Ticket: TidySweep branch-cleanup bot failing signature verification on deploy. Since last night's pipeline run, the bot's release artifact is rejected by the Quillhaven verification step with a key mismatch. Root cause: the previous signing credential expired and the pipeline still references it. No tampering indicators found in the audit log. Requesting security review sign-off on the replacement. The new deploy key to register is the following.

rollout seal: bky4_x7Gc

Subject: Canary gating ownership change. Effective immediately, gating rules for Driftline canary deploys move from Platform to the Release Engineering pod. Threshold edits, overrides, and rollback triggers now require pod approval. Update your runbooks before Friday's release train. All gating exceptions must be approved by the new owner.

named custodian: Oliath Ralax

## Releases

Hey support folks — quick notes on ProfileMesh shard releases. Each release re-balances user-profile shards gradually, so don't panic if a lookup lands on a stale shard for a few minutes post-deploy; it self-heals. Release bundles are published twice a month and are always signed. If a customer asks you to verify a bundle they downloaded, walk them through the checksum step using the public signing key below.

deploy key for kawif-bageg: bky19_YQNdHDgpaLxUNwPoHm9

## DiffPane: Large File Handling

Plugins rendering diffs through DiffPane must respect the 40 MB soft limit. Above that threshold, DiffPane switches to chunked mode and your hunk callbacks receive partial ranges instead of full buffers. Do not assume line offsets are stable across chunks; query the anchor API each time. If your plugin crashes in chunked mode, reproduce with the sample fixture and capture the token printed below.

session token of yahof-bajeg = htk9_0d43d44ed

## Service accounts — cron drift investigation

During the October drift investigation on the Hourglade scheduler, we found the `svc-relay` service account's jobs firing up to 40 seconds late because its node pool used an unsynced clock source. Support should note that affected customers may see staggered report times rather than missed runs. The account has since been pinned to NTP-verified nodes. To query the Hourglade audit endpoint for a customer's job history, authenticate with the internal key listed directly beneath this section.

API key for kahop-bagef: zpat2_yb